The video explores the concept of proton decay, a phenomenon not yet observed but predicted by many physicists. The Standard Model of particle physics suggests protons are stable, but its complexity and limitations have led scientists to seek alternative theories, such as Grand Unified Theories (GUTs). These theories propose that at high energies, the fundamental forces unify, and protons may decay into lighter particles. Experiments, like those involving large water tanks, aim to detect such decays, which could provide insights into the universe's fundamental nature.
